OBS Spout2插件完整指南:3步实现跨程序高清视频流传输
OBS Spout2插件是一款专为Windows平台设计的强大工具,能够在OBS Studio与其他Spout2兼容程序之间实现高效的高分辨率视频流共享。这个插件彻底改变了传统视频传输方式,为用户提供了更加流畅和专业的视频制作体验。
🚀 为什么你需要这个插件?
传统的视频传输方式存在诸多限制,而OBS Spout2插件提供了革命性的解决方案:
- 突破分辨率限制:支持4K及更高分辨率的视频流传输
- 极低延迟表现:确保实时画面传输的流畅性
- 跨程序协作:在不同创意软件间无缝传递视频内容
- 资源效率优化:减少CPU和GPU的额外负担
📋 快速安装:从零开始的完整流程
系统要求检查
在开始安装前,请确保您的系统满足以下基本要求:
- Windows 10或更高版本操作系统
- 已安装最新版OBS Studio
- 支持DirectX 11或更高版本的显卡
- 至少8GB内存(推荐16GB以上)
下载与安装步骤
-
获取安装包 访问项目仓库下载最新版本的安装程序:
git clone --recursive https://gitcode.com/gh_mirrors/ob/obs-spout2-plugin -
运行安装程序
- 双击运行
OBS_Spout2_Plugin_Installer.exe - 如遇安全提示,选择"更多信息"→"仍要运行"
- 选择正确的OBS安装目录(通常会自动检测)
- 双击运行
-
验证安装结果
- 重启OBS Studio
- 在源面板中右键,应能看到"Spout2 Source"选项
🎯 核心功能详解:输入与输出配置
Spout2输入源设置
在OBS中添加Spout2输入源非常简单:
- 右键点击源面板→"添加"→"Spout2 Source"
- 为源命名以便识别
- 在属性面板中选择要接收的Spout2流名称
- 调整分辨率和帧率设置以匹配源内容
Spout2输出配置
配置OBS输出到其他Spout2程序:
- 在输出设置中找到Spout2输出选项
- 设置输出名称(其他程序将通过此名称识别)
- 选择是否启用自动启动功能
💡 实战应用:5个高效使用场景
场景1:游戏直播特效处理
将游戏画面通过Spout2输出到视频特效软件,添加实时特效后再传回OBS进行直播推流。
场景2:虚拟现实内容制作
在VR制作流程中,使用Spout2在不同渲染引擎和OBS之间传递视频流,实现复杂的视觉效果叠加。
场景3:多机位远程协作
通过Spout2技术建立多台计算机间的视频流网络,实现分布式视频制作和实时协作。
场景4:专业视频后期流程
将OBS中的录制内容直接输出到专业视频编辑软件,避免重新编码带来的质量损失。
场景5:实时绿幕合成
利用Spout2传输带Alpha通道的视频流,在不同软件间进行实时绿幕合成处理。
🔧 常见问题与解决方案
问题1:插件未显示在OBS中
解决方案:
- 确认插件安装到正确的OBS plugins目录
- 检查OBS版本兼容性
- 重启OBS Studio
问题2:画面延迟或卡顿
解决方案:
- 降低输出分辨率设置
- 更新显卡驱动程序
- 检查系统资源占用情况
问题3:连接状态不稳定
解决方案:
- 确保发送端和接收端程序同时运行
- 验证Spout2名称拼写是否正确
- 检查防火墙设置是否阻止了程序通信
⚡ 性能优化技巧:获得最佳体验
为了充分发挥OBS Spout2插件的性能潜力,建议采用以下优化策略:
-
硬件加速配置 在OBS设置中启用NVENC或AMD硬件编码器,显著提升处理效率。
-
分辨率匹配原则 确保发送端和接收端使用相同的分辨率设置,避免不必要的缩放计算。
-
帧率优化设置 根据实际需求选择适当的帧率,30fps适用于大多数场景,60fps适合高速动作内容。
-
内存管理建议 定期清理系统缓存,关闭不必要的后台程序,确保有足够的内存资源。
🎓 进阶功能探索
Alpha通道支持
Spout2插件支持传输带透明通道的视频内容,这对于绿幕合成和图层叠加等高级应用至关重要。
多实例运行
可以同时创建多个Spout2源和输出,处理不同的视频流,满足复杂制作需求。
自定义分辨率设置
支持非标准分辨率的视频流传输,为特殊制作需求提供灵活性。
📝 开发者指南:编译与贡献
如果您是开发者,想要编译自己的版本或为项目贡献力量:
-
环境准备
- 安装CMake 3.28或更高版本
- 配置Windows x64架构的开发环境
-
编译流程
- 使用CMake配置项目
- 生成解决方案文件
- 编译生成插件文件
详细编译说明请参考项目中的CMakeLists.txt文件和相关构建脚本。
🎉 开始你的Spout2之旅
OBS Spout2插件为视频创作者打开了一个全新的可能性世界。无论您是直播主播、视频制作人还是专业内容创作者,这个工具都能显著提升您的工作效率和创作质量。
立即开始使用,体验高清视频流共享带来的革命性变化!
官方文档:docs/official.md 界面源码:source/ui/
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0194-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
awesome-zig一个关于 Zig 优秀库及资源的协作列表。Makefile00